KORE Group Holdings Delivers Impressive Q3 Financial Results
KORE Group Holdings, Inc. (NYSE: KORE), a prominent player in the Internet of Things (IoT) sector, has reported resilient financial performance for the third quarter of 2025. The company has demonstrated commendable growth in key metrics such as adjusted EBITDA, connections, and free cash flow, while also reducing its net loss.
Third Quarter Highlights
The third quarter saw KORE achieving significant operational milestones:
- The company generated revenues totaling $68.7 million, remaining relatively stable compared to the previous year's results.
- Total connections surged to 20.5 million, marking a substantial increase of 9% from 18.8 million in the same quarter last year.
- Net loss improved to $12.7 million, a decrease of $6.7 million or 35% year-over-year.
- Adjusted EBITDA increased to $14.5 million, reflecting a year-over-year growth of 12%.
- Cash provided by operations was steady at $1.1 million.
- Free cash flow saw a notable improvement, increasing to negative $1.1 million, up $1.1 million from the same period last year.
Ron Totton, President & CEO of KORE, expressed satisfaction with the company’s performance, highlighting the successful execution of their profitable growth strategy. He stated, "The continued growth in Total Connections, exceeding 20.5 million, alongside a 12% rise in Adjusted EBITDA, underscores our effective approach. We are excited about strengthening demand within our connectivity services, and we expect this trend to persist through the remainder of 2025 and into 2026."
Financial Overview
KORE's financial metrics reflect impressive operational efficiency. The details of the third-quarter performance are as follows:
Financial Metrics Comparison
- **Revenue Last Year**: $68.9 million
- **IoT Connectivity Revenue**: $56.7 million, consistent with approximately 83% of total revenue.
- **IoT Solutions Revenue**: $11.9 million, which constitutes about 17% of total revenue.
Moreover, the average connections for this period stood at 20.4 million, showcasing KORE’s gradual growth in connectivity services.
Strategic Initiatives and Future Outlook
In a significant recent development, KORE announced that it received correspondence from Searchlight Capital Partners and Abry Partners concerning their interest in acquiring all outstanding shares not already held by these funds. In response, KORE's Board of Directors has formed a Special Committee to evaluate and negotiate any potential strategic transaction. The company acknowledges that predicting the outcomes of this review is complex, which has led to the suspension of guidance for the remainder of the fiscal year.
The management expressed that while there is no guarantee that the strategic review will yield a transaction, they remain optimistic about their ongoing initiatives and market position.
